Otley:
We enjoyed a run over to Otley for a change of scenery this morning.
We had a look at the shops (mainly charity shops) for some 1,000 piece Jigsaws for Sue.
We struck gold in a couple of shops with quite a good selection at rock bottom prices.
(Hope all the pieces are there).
Brunch at a smart Wetherspoons was cracking as well.
[Breakfast Muffin (Bacon, Egg, Sausage, Bit of Cheese and a coffee) £3.17 !! or pretty close to that, I think]
Afterwards we had a short walk along the riverside, although we were intending to go a lot further at the outset, the heavy rain put a 'dampener' on the job!
Nevertheless we did see a few birds on the shorter version.
Earlier, while we were stopped at some traffic lights in Shipley, I took a few speculative photos of a distant tall chimney.
A Peregrine was just visible on the chimney when I zoomed the photo, on the laptop, later.
A Red Kite was very distant, airborne, as we came past the Chevin Pub on our way home and a Curlew called.
So given the weather - not a bad do.

Birds:
Otley:
Many Black Headed Gull, 1 Lesser Black-backed Gull.
2 Mute Swan, Mallard, Moorhen.
Pr. Goosander.
Pr. Mandarin Duck.
Redwing.
Otley Chevin:
Red Kite, Curlew.
Shipley:
Peregrine Falcon.
Bradshaw Fields:
4 Chaffinch, Greenfinch, c15 Common Gull, 2 Black Headed Gull, 26 Starling.
Distant, wet looking, Sparrowhawk.
PR. Little Owl and a few other sp.
